Opening January 31st in The Domain NORTHSIDE, Ēma brings a Mediterranean wardrobe of flavors filtered through Chef Partner CJ Jacobson’s lighter California sensibility. Expect bright vegetable-forward plates, shareable small bites, and a relaxed, sunlit dining room that feels equal parts coastal and local. It’s a fresh, unfussy take on Mediterranean cooking tailored for Austin’s seasonal harvest.
What to Order
Charred Octopus with Lemon-Pistachio
Tender, smoky octopus finished with bright citrus and crunchy pistachio for a textural Mediterranean opener.
Heirloom Tomato & Burrata
Ripe local tomatoes, silky burrata, herbs and olive oil — a simple, sunlit celebration of summer produce.
Grilled Lamb Shoulder with Herb Yogurt
Slow-grilled lamb shredded and dressed in tangy herbed yogurt, served with warm flatbread for sharing.
